Milwaukee Bucks at Miami Heat – 1/12/23 NBA Picks and Prediction

The Milwaukee Bucks and the Miami Heat duke it out at the FTX Arena on Thursday night.

The Milwaukee Bucks have been in fine form as they’ve won five of their last seven games overall and they will be aiming for a third straight victory after beating the Hawks in a 114-105 road win last night. Jrue Holiday led the way with 27 points and five assists, Brook Lopez added 20 points with 12 rebounds and two blocks while Bobby Portis chipped in with 13 points and 10 rebounds off the bench. As a team, the Bucks shot 45 percent from the field and 18 of 48 from the 3-point line as they squandered an early 24-point lead, before going on a decisive 8-0 run in the fourth quarter to pull away and avoid an embarrassing loss in the end.  

Meanwhile, the Miami Heat have been in great shape as they’ve won six of their last nine games overall and they will be aiming to stay hot after sneaking past the Thunder in a thrilling 112-111 home win on Tuesday. Jimmy Butler led the team with 35 points, seven rebounds, four assists, four steals and three blocks, Max Strus added 22 points while Victor Oladipo chipped in with a crucial 19 points off the bench. As a team, the Heat shot just 39 percent from the field and 10 of 33 from the 3-point line as they poured in 63 points in the first half to build a nine-point lead, but after the Thunder rallied all the way back to take the lead, the Heat went to Butler who drained the game-winning free throw to carry the Heat over the line in a tight finish.
